Over 55% of Indian startup founders struggle with sleep
A recent survey found that over 55% of startup founders and business leaders in five major Indian cities struggle with sleep. More than 26% of professionals reported getting less than six hours of sleep each night. The survey, conducted by Heartfulness and TiE Global, revealed that sleep deprivation affects job performance and workplace relationships. Stress and anxiety were identified as the main causes of sleep difficulties, with many entrepreneurs experiencing frequent disturbances. To address these issues, TiE Global and Heartfulness will offer sleep wellness workshops for members worldwide, starting with a virtual session on March 21.
